The Rise of Soft Robotics and Artificial Intelligence
One of the most significant trends in medical robotics and automation is the emergence of soft robotics and artificial intelligence (AI). Soft robotics refers to the development of robots that can safely interact with and manipulate delicate tissues and organs, while AI enables these robots to learn from data and make decisions in real-time. This combination of soft robotics and AI has the potential to revolutionize surgical procedures, enable more precise diagnosis and treatment, and improve patient outcomes. Advances in Haptics and Teleoperation
Another area of innovation in medical robotics and automation is the development of advanced haptics and teleoperation systems. Haptics refers to the sense of touch and feedback, while teleoperation enables remote control of robots and other devices. These technologies have the potential to enhance the precision and dexterity of surgical procedures, enable more effective training and simulation, and improve patient care.
